Router: Archer C9
Firmware: 27119
Status: Working
Reset: No
Errors: None
Previous: 27096
LAN led not working.
When i enable JFFS2 Support, partition mtdblock3 is mounted on /jffs/. Everything is OK, but when I reboot router it starts with the factory settings and JFFS2 Support is disable.
dmesg:
[...]Creating 6 MTD partitions on "bcmsflash":
0x000000000000-0x000000040000 : "boot"
0x000000040000-0x000000ff0000 : "linux"
0x0000001c0000-0x000000d70000 : "rootfs"
0x000000d70000-0x000000ff0000 : "ddwrt"
0x000000ff0000-0x000001000000 : "nvram_cfe"
0x000000fe0000-0x000000ff0000 : "nvram"
nflash: found no supported devices[...]
